Simon Harriyott: Autastic

United Kingdom - England
Performer / Performance company

Simon Harriyott

In his award-nominated stand-up show, Autastic, we meet Simon: a software-developing, Rubik's cube-solving, accordion-playing, anagram-spotting, blue plaque-collecting, grammar-correcting, manor-dwelling, bell-ringing, Morris-dancing nerd. Five years ago, Simon was surprisingly surprised to discover he is autistic. Join him as he questions everything he's ever done, dismantles his life, rebuilds it, and discovers the fantastic and drastic sides of autism.
